epidendrum-falcatumThis epiphyte is very interesting ,and not only when in bloom :its unusual looking overhanging tufts of long leaves will undoubtedly spruce up any collection. And any orchid lover is bound to fall for them when they are accompanied by the snow-white flowers with their strangely positioned lips ! The species E. falcatum used to be under the name Auliza parkinsoniana. Narrow lanceolate fleshy leaves reaching lengths of up to 12 in/30 cm grow out of the rudiments of the intensely reduced pseudobulbs . No more than 3 large white flowers can be admired on the shorter flower spike . The lip turns somewhat yellow in time .It is three -lobed -the two lateral lobes are oval ,the middle one is slim and pointed . Cultivation is easy ;it is more of a proble to acquire this fairly rare and highly valued species with low propogation ability in the first place . Grow the plant as you would other thermophilic orchids ,that is ,epiphytically on a slab of bark(cork oak is recommended )in semi-shade. The plant easily tolerates being placed in small,poorly ventilated epiphytic cases . It blooms in high summer and was discovered in Mexico ,Guatemala,Honduras,Costa Rica and Panama.
